5 Signs You May Have Hidden Water Damage In Your Home

Water damage is a common problem for homeowners, and if you have it in your home, you should not wait to get it taken care of. Water damage can lead to ruined drywall, mold growth, structural damage, and electrical issues. Here are five signs that you might have water damage somewhere in your home and should contact a water damage restoration company.

Higher Water Bill

This one may be a little surprising, but if you notice your water bill has gone up in recent months, it could be a sign that you have water damage. It could be that a leaky pipe is constantly dripping water or an appliance that is malfunctioning and using more water than it is supposed to. If you notice a significant rise in your water bill, you may want to search for hidden water damage.

Bubbling, Cracked, Or Peeling Paint

If water leaks from your ceiling or behind your walls, you may notice damage to your paint. Water that has leaked in might form what looks like bubbles in the paint as they create small pockets of water. You may also notice that paint in a certain area has developed spider web-like cracks due to moisture trapped behind it. It is also possible that paint will begin to peel off your wall. These are all signs that trapped water inside your wall needs professional attention.

Discoloration

Do you notice rings that look like rust forming on your walls or ceiling? These rings are another sign that you could have water damage where you cannot see it. It often weakens the paint or wallpaper you have and can cause discoloration in an area. If you notice this, the damage must be addressed before painting over it. Otherwise, the new paint will become damaged as well. Whatever is causing the water damage to leak in must again be dried completely and repaired to prevent the damage from returning or worsening.

Curly Floorboards

Water damage also frequently occurs under your floor. If you notice your floorboards or tiles disconnecting from one another, this is a sign of water damage. Floorboards that unstick from the ground and wall and begin to curl inward are also a sign of water damage. If your floors or tiles are losing their adhesiveness, you may want to check for water damage underneath them. Water damage restoration specialists can test humidity levels and help you identify any water damage.

Musty Odors

If you notice a musty odor in areas of your home, you might have mold. Along with water damage comes mold. You may notice mold springing up in visible places, but mold often forms in dark unseen areas.
